|
|
@@ -28,10 +28,6 @@ class DnsHelper
|
|
|
$server = Server::select('id', 'nameserver1ip', 'nameserver2ip')->findOrFail($params['serverid']);
|
|
|
$nameserver = array(trim($server->nameserver1ip), trim($server->nameserver2ip));
|
|
|
$clientDomains = localAPI('GetClientsDomains', array('clientid' => $params['userid']));
|
|
|
- if($clientDomains['totalresults'] == 0){
|
|
|
- $vars['selfDNS'] = FALSE;
|
|
|
- return $vars;
|
|
|
- }
|
|
|
$configOption = new ConfigOptionsHelper;
|
|
|
|
|
|
logModuleCall(
|
|
|
@@ -42,6 +38,10 @@ class DnsHelper
|
|
|
$clientDomains
|
|
|
);
|
|
|
|
|
|
+ if($clientDomains['totalresults'] == 0){
|
|
|
+ $vars['selfDNS'] = FALSE;
|
|
|
+ return $vars;
|
|
|
+ }
|
|
|
$resolver = new \Net_DNS2_Resolver(array('nameservers' => $nameserver));
|
|
|
try {
|
|
|
$result = $resolver->query($params['domain'], 'MX');
|